Can anyone recommend a brush on paint that would stay put on a manifold?
I have been using a silver colour product which came from where I worked and was supposed to be good for 650c which will stay on most of the exhaust but doesn't like the manifold much!

Re: High Temperature Paint
Think with the manifold, its more down to the preparation of the material. How depending on how hot the manifold actually gets (Not something I'm aware of really) but if the manifold is rusty it won't adhere properly and the heat will just cause it to flake.
